Christoph Berg <myon@debian.org> writes:
> I've always been wondering why we don't set a log_line_prefix by
> default.

I think the odds of getting to something that everyone would agree on
are nil, so I'm not excited about getting into that particular
bikeshed-painting discussion.  Look at the amount of trouble we're
having converging on a default for the regression tests, which are
a far narrower use-case than "everybody".

> The above looks quite similar to what the Debian packages have been
> setting as their default for some time, with standard stderr logging:

I think Debian's choice was probably made by fiat, not by consensus.
Packagers seem to be able to get away with quite a lot in that regard.
